Why Automotive AC Evacuation Pump Is Necessary
I have found that an automotive AC evacuation pump is necessary because it helps remove air, moisture, and unwanted gases from the AC system before recharging it. When I skip this step, the system can hold moisture that may freeze, cause corrosion, or reduce cooling performance. For me, evacuation is one of the most important parts of making sure the AC works properly and lasts longer.
I also use an evacuation pump because it helps create a proper vacuum in the system. This lets me check for leaks before I add refrigerant. If the system cannot hold vacuum, I know there is a problem that needs attention first. That saves me time, refrigerant, and frustration later.
From my experience, a clean and dry AC system cools better and runs more efficiently. The evacuation pump helps protect the compressor and other components from damage caused by contamination. In my opinion, it is a simple tool that makes a big difference in AC service quality.

Single-Stage vs. Two-Stage
I usually compare single-stage and two-stage pumps before making a choice. A single-stage pump can work well for basic jobs, but I prefer a two-stage pump when I want better performance and faster evacuation. In my view, two-stage pumps are worth considering if I plan to use the tool often or work on multiple vehicles.
